Solid foam drainage agent composition and preparation method and application thereof
A technology of composition and foaming agent, which is applied in the direction of drilling composition, chemical instruments and methods, etc., and can solve problems such as difficulties, liquid injection stop, gas well production reduction, etc.

Embodiment 1
[0040] (1) Under normal temperature and pressure, 10 grams of alkylamine polyether carboxylate, 20 grams of long-chain polyether nitrogen-containing compounds, and 30 grams of sodium sulfate are mixed uniformly to obtain a mixture;
[0041] (2) 0.1 gram of polyacrylamide is added with 1 gram of water and stirred until completely dissolved to obtain a binder solution;
[0042] (3) The mixture obtained in step (1) and the binder solution obtained in step (2) were uniformly mixed, and pressed to form a solid foam drainage stick FS-1, whose component structure is shown in Table 1.
Embodiment 2
[0044] (1) Under normal temperature and pressure, 5 grams of alkylamine polyether carboxylate, 50 grams of long-chain polyether nitrogen-containing compounds, 30 grams of sodium sulfate, 10 grams of sodium carbonate, 30 grams of sodium bicarbonate, and 30 grams of urea Mix well to get a mixture;
[0045] (2) Add 0.5 g of polyethylene glycol with 2 g of water and stir until completely dissolved to obtain a binder solution;
[0046] (3) The mixture obtained in step (1) and the binder solution obtained in step (2) were mixed evenly, and pressed to form a solid foam drainage rod FS-2, whose component structure is shown in Table 1.
Embodiment 3
[0048] (1) Under normal temperature and pressure, 50 grams of alkylamine polyether carboxylate, 10 grams of long-chain polyether nitrogen-containing compounds, 10 grams of urea, and 1 gram of citric acid were mixed uniformly to obtain a mixture;
[0049] (2) Add 0.1 g of starch and 2 g of water and stir until completely dissolved to obtain a binder solution;
[0050] (3) The mixture obtained in step (1) and the binder solution obtained in step (2) were uniformly mixed, and pressed to form a solid foam drainage stick FS-3, whose component structure is shown in Table 1.
